Text

‘After Dark’ 2LP comes out November 29th on American Dreams Records.
It’s an album of turntable reconstructions based on Debussy’s ‘La Mer’.

The 405 premiered the video for “Blue Leaves” today. Directed, shot and edited by Nathan Melaragno. I met Nathan last year while he was performing with my friends Organic Dial in Cleveland. He’s an incredibly gifted video artist with a sensitive eye for subtle moments. The video was shot in my old neighborhood & at my family’s home on a Sunday afternoon in Westlake, while I was in town on tour last month.
